    Oh, one thing am unhappy with regarding daily rewards is the notification each day. I find it quite distracting and am often in the middle of something. Perhaps just me but that stupid flashing glowing notification bubble distracts me until I can get to it. As luck has it, the notification often goes off in the middle of a group dungeon and is for AP (which I want on a different character). Lol. Surely there must be a less obtrusive way to notify us about something that is going to happen every single day at exactly the same time.

    Smaller rewards could include a LOT more variety. Instead of the same 3 - 4 items repeating over and over, maybe add some others like transmute crystals, writ vouchers, event tickets or other crown consumables. I'd shift things such as riding lessons 100% and 150% xp scrolls and cooldown reducers to the common slots, though they don't have to show up as often as others.

    I'd have 4 guaranteed large rewards per month. No consumables. Costumes, pets, collectibles, large currency rewards like 100k gold or 500k AP, mounts, crown crates or DLC's. Basically keep it interesting and vary it from month to month.

    I'd prefer more collectibles for the rare/starred rewards, including a return of the Crown Crates. Things like Exp scrolls, riding lessons and other consumables have no business being the starred rewards as they just aren't that special. New outfits, hair-do's, accessories, pets, mounts and cool furnishings are all fantastic rewards. I'd also prefer the lesser rewards stop being consumables that most players consider throw-aways and instead stick to various currencies like gold, telvar, and AP. Heck, with the 5-week anniversary event coming up and the many items which will be available via the special vendor, they could even add extra tickets as a log-in reward currency. Themed reward months would also be a fantastic idea. Heck, it's only limited by their imaginations and could be a fantastic system, should they choose to support it better with more creative rewards.

    However, my expectations are quite different. I expect the daily log-in rewards are going to continue getting diluted overall. They'll probably spike and have something epic during the main month of the anniversary event, but then go right back to diminishing rewards each month afterwards. Eventually, once the rewards have lessened to a degree that they muster more serious player outcries, they'll finally decide to get rid of the system altogether and in their usual manner try to spin getting rid of it as a new "feature". Those are my predictions.

    It would be nice to have a wider, more diverse selection, with less repetition over the course of the month.
    Some ideas:

    - a special motif; one page a month, two on holidays, account-bound. If you miss any pieces, you will be able to get them next year from the Impressario, or something);
    - build-your-own transform memento / skin / mount - gather five pieces, one for each month (pieces would come early each month to minimize the risk of people missing on them).
    - crafting plans for discontinued crown store furniture pack items; not all at once, more like a bed in January, a bathtub in March, and so on;
    - minor cosmetics like tiaras, facepaints, lipsticks, eyelashes, contact lenses. Not only there's a large backlog of discontinued cosmetics, but the new ones are extremely easy and cheap to crank out in large quantities.
    - instead of some of the consumables, hand out their value in crown gems. Not too much, about fifteen or twenty a month - but still enough that a dedicated player can save up enough for a 100 gem mount or two 40 gem costumes, if they are so inclined.
